Kris Sinclair - CEO of The Texas Royalty & Mineral Company joins the podcast in an emotional discussion around the adversity he and his partner Max Gallegos had to overcome two years ago when Toby Martinez suffered a medical incident that suddenly removed him as CEO of The Texas Mineral Company. **Disclaimer: This podcast is meant for informational purposes only and does not constitute investment advice.
